KANDAHAR, Afghanistan — Taliban insurgents attacked a police checkpoint north of the city early Monday, killing 11 police officers and burning their vehicles before vanishing into the night.
A spokesman for the Taliban, Qari Yousuf Ahmadi, claimed responsibility for the attack by telephone.
In a separate attack Sunday west of Kandahar, two British soldiers were killed in an explosion and two others were wounded, the British Defense Ministry announced in London.
